Handover — calibration weights, Bay 4

Marek, the batch of twelve calibration weights from Vellant Metrology came back from re-certification this morning. I've checked each against the manifest; the 5 kg unit has a fresh seal, the rest are unchanged. They're boxed in the grey crate on the staging shelf, strapped and labelled for the Tornquist lab run tomorrow. Do not stack anything on top — the foam inserts shift easily. The courier from Ridgeline Transit arrives at 09:30 sharp. Give the driver the following instruction at hand-over:

handover note for hafop-yageg: the soriel tamys courier leaves the tamdor quenok aldvan ledger at gate 5357 under passcode 293424

# Welcome! This is the env file for the Cartonpath webhook listener.
# It receives parcel-scan events from the Quickhaul depot network and
# pushes them onto the notify queue. Tweak PORT and QUEUE_NAME if your
# local setup clashes, but leave RETRY_MAX alone. Incoming payloads are
# signature-checked, and the shared secret for that check is set on the
# next line.

secret setting of yajog-taguf: ARCHIVE_KEY3=051

# LiftLogic simulator settings
#
# Support folks: this block controls where the elevator-dispatch
# simulator stores its run history. Don't touch the tick-rate or
# car-count values unless someone from the Brindle team asks —
# weird numbers here make the replays look haunted. If a customer
# reports missing simulation runs, first check that the history
# table is reachable. The simulator reads its storage target from
# the connection string on the next line.

replica DSN, kajep-yahag: mssql://praok_svc:iF@db-8d68.plorvaio.local:5432/eliion